Originally Posted by Black Nugget,Mar 6 2007, 10:43 AM
This is my first time in Fontana.... staying in a magnolia, other than food & drinks what all do we need?
Plastic cups for sure. Paper towels and/or napkins are essential. Might want to grab some dish soap and a sponge (after DBR, we were a bit unsure of whether the cabin was supposed to have those, but for a few bucks you're probably better safe than sorry).

The cabins have towels, but not many, so if you have a stocked cabin (like D8's) a few extra towels might not hurt. Take an alarm clock, some of the cabins we had didn't have a clock in them.
